Your role

The HR Services Manager leads a team delivering operational excellence in HR Systems, Advice, and Administration (via PSS and local teams). This role ensures seamless execution of critical HR processes with a customer-first approach, while contributing to HR initiatives, business improvement projects, and the development of new services.

  • Lead end-to-end HR service delivery, ensuring efficiency and quality through the HR Services Team

  • Provide expert HR advice to managers, employees, and HR on policies, processes, and complex employee matters (e.g., probation, agreement interpretation)

  • Establish and maintain HR infrastructure, including standard processes and compliance frameworks

  • Manage and develop the HR team, ensuring optimal staffing, budget adherence, and competency planning

  • Oversee HR Systems delivery, including administration, reporting, analytics, and system enhancements

  • Drive customer-centric improvements, aligning service offerings with organisational goals and HR strategy

  • Act as key contact for PSS service delivery to Australia, ensuring quality and service level compliance

  • Collaborate across HR, CoE, Domain HR, and Finance to ensure seamless service handoffs and operational efficiency

  • Enhance employee experience through efficient HR transactional services

  • Boost user engagement and ensure support materials are effective and fit for purpose

What We Do

Thales is a global high technology leader investing in digital and “deep tech” innovations – connectivity, big data,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ity and quantum technology – to build a future we can all trust, which is vital to the development of our societies. The company provides solutions, services and products that help its customers – businesses, organisations and states – in the defence, aeronautics, space, transportation and digital identity and security markets to fulfil their critical missions, by placing humans at the heart of the decision-making process.
